Steven Hao Shao-Wen (Chinese: 郝劭文) is a Taiwanese actor born in Taipei. He is sometimes credited as Kok Siu-Man and Fok Siu-Man in Cantonese. He became famous as a child actor in the mid-1990s, starring in films such as Ten Brothers (十兄弟) and Trouble Maker (蠟筆小小生). He took a break from acting in 2003 to focus on his studies. In 2008, he was admitted to the Department of Transportation Management at Tamkang University. He returned to acting the next year.
